Aerospace Battery Grade Lithium Carbonate
Battery grade lithium carbonate is a white crystalline powder that is odorless, tasteless, and has stable chemical properties. It has low solubility in water, but exhibits good solubility in organic solvents. In addition, battery grade lithium carbonate has high purity, high specific surface area, high shrinkage rate, high chemical stability, electrochemical stability, and thermal stability. These characteristics make battery grade lithium carbonate an ideal battery material, widely used in the manufacturing of lithium-ion batteries.

Product parameters
Name | Battery grade lithium carbonate | |
Content not less than( % ) Li2CO3 | 99.50 | |
Impurity content not exceeding(ppm) | Na | 250 |
K | 10 | |
Ca | 50 | |
Mg | 80 | |
F | 10 | |
Cu | 3 | |
Pb | 3 | |
Ni | 10 | |
Mn | 3 | |
Zn | 3 | |
Al | 10 | |
Si | 30 | |
SO42- | 800 | |
Cl- | 30 | |
H2O(%) not more than | 0.25 |
